Dark chocolate is produced by adding fat and sugar to cocoa.

It differs from milk chocolate in that it contains little to no milk solids.

Dark Chocolate & Cherry Trail Mix step by step

  1. Mix together everything except the dark chocolate and cherries..

  2. Spread on a baking tray and bake at 150 C for 15 minutes..

  3. Allow to cool then mix in the dried cherries and chocolate..
